The graticule in London West contains the City, West End, and many western boroughs. It also extends as far as Slough and Reading to the west, Luton to the north, and Crawley to the south.

The graticule has boundaries from 52° to 51° latitude, and -1° to -0° longitude. When following the XKCD geohashing algorithm, append the fractional hash part to 51° latitude and -0° longitude. Note the use of negative zero.
